Serif Flared Esdef 7 is a regular weight, normal width, medium cont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

This serif shows sculpted, flaring stroke endings and bracketed serifs that feel carved rather than mechanically square. Strokes exhibit clear but controlled contrast, with smooth transitions into tapered terminals and subtly swelling verticals. Proportions are moderately compact with sturdy capitals, while lowercase forms keep a steady, readable rhythm; counters are generous and curves are round yet disciplined. The numerals and caps maintain a consistent, dignified texture, with slightly varied letter widths that add natural, text-like cadence.

It will perform well for long-form reading in books and editorial layouts where a traditional serif texture is desired. The sculpted terminals and sturdy capitals also make it effective for magazine headlines, pull quotes, and refined brand typography that needs gravitas without overt ornamentation.

The overall tone is classic and editorial, suggesting bookish authority with a hint of old-style warmth. Its flared finishing gives it a crafted, heritage feel—refined rather than flashy—well suited to serious, literary messaging.

The design appears intended to blend classical serif conventions with flared, subtly calligraphic finishing to achieve a warm, authoritative reading experience. It prioritizes a cohesive text color and familiar proportions while adding distinctive modeling at stroke endings for character.

In the text sample the face holds together into a dark, confident color, with crisp joins and a steady baseline presence. The flared details become most visible at larger sizes, while at paragraph scale they read as soft, traditional serif modeling rather than decorative ornament.
